Spamming
Webmasters just starting out often make the SEO mistake of inputting far too many keywords into their text that aren’t specific. Yes, keywords happen to be an important element of SEO, but if you go on and stuff a high number of keywords in your content, then it will only get you into trouble with the search engines as they will penalize your website for spamming. You’ll lose your ranking due to the over abundance of the keywords on your site, which means you’ll lose the traffic too. Your traffic will become displeased as they’re more interested in information they can read and that offers something they can use.
Internal Linking
Internal linking is one of the most overlooked SEO strategies most people. Your internal linking structure is one more of the few SEO factors that you completely control. Linking strategy is a gem that is not even employed by most and you can reap the rewards of having higher page rankings. Instead of focusing on sending your visitors away you should concentrate on linking all of your related pages together in a logical fashion. But when you put everything in place, you’ll see great results. And these results last for a long time. If you go to Wikipedia and search for something of interest, you will notice that they have links to many other related topics that are on their site, that is a prime example of internal linking.
Poor Content
When adding content to your site you must please both the readers and the search engine. Another basic SEO strategy is to present the search engines with content that answers the questions of what a searcher is looking for and to format it in a predetermined way. Having bad content on your site is a sure shot recipe towards failure when it comes to SEO. Your articles and posts should be no less than 300 words and have a keyword density of 3%-5%. The page title should match the keywords of the specific content. Avoid any form of keyword stuffing in your content as it can harm your ranking.
Above all, it’s important to stay away from excessive flash, but if you include images make sure you’re using ALT tags. Avoiding the above mistakes will most definitely help your rankings and keep you safe from getting banned.
